Stress Laundering Wood Surfaces
When pressure washing wood surface areas, it's important to choose the right tools and technique to prevent damages. Start by choosing a stress washer with flexible settings. A lower stress, typically between 1,200 to 1,500 PSI, is ideal for wood. This aids avoid gouging or stripping the timber fibers.
Before you begin, make sure to remove the area of furniture, plants, and other obstacles. It's important to examine a small, unnoticeable area initially to ensure your method and stress settings won't harm the surface.
Utilize a follower nozzle add-on for an even circulation of water. Hold the nozzle at a 45-degree angle and at least 12 inches away from the timber to decrease the threat of damages.
As you wash, move in long, sweeping movements along the grain of the timber. This method helps lift dirt and particles effectively without leaving streaks.
After washing, rinse the surface area extensively to eliminate any kind of continuing to be cleansing option. Enable the timber to completely dry entirely before using any kind of sealer or tarnish. Following these steps will ensure your timber surface areas remain in excellent problem while looking fresh and tidy.
Techniques for Cleaning Concrete
Concrete surface areas can collect dust, crud, and stains with time, making effective cleansing strategies vital. To begin, you'll want to use a stress washer with a minimum of 3000 PSI for concrete cleaning. This degree of pressure effectively eliminates stubborn discolorations without damaging the surface area.
Prior to you start, spray the area with a concrete cleaner or a mix of detergent and water. Permit it to dwell for concerning 10-15 minutes; this helps break down hard stains.
Next off, affix a wide spray nozzle to your pressure washer, preferably a 25-degree or 40-degree suggestion. This will certainly distribute the water evenly and reduce the danger of etching.
When you begin pressure washing, work in areas. Keep the nozzle regarding 12 inches from the surface area and preserve a consistent, sweeping activity. This strategy guarantees you do not miss out on any areas or apply excessive stress in one area.
For specifically persistent stains, you might require to repeat the process or make use of an extra focused cleaner.
Lastly, rinse the location completely after cleansing. This step avoids any kind of deposit from continuing to be on the concrete, leaving it tidy and looking fresh.
Best Practices for Plastic Home Siding
Vinyl home siding is a preferred selection for property owners due to its sturdiness and reduced upkeep needs. Nevertheless, to keep it looking its finest, you'll need to pressure wash it regularly.
Begin by preparing the location-- eliminate any kind of furnishings, plants, or barriers near your home. Next, choose a stress washing machine with a nozzle that provides a vast spray; normally, a 25-degree nozzle works well.
Before you start, examine a small section to ensure your setups will not harm the siding. Maintain the pressure listed below 2000 PSI to prevent any kind of damages or fractures. Begin with the bottom and function your means up, washing in areas to avoid streaks.
Make use of a detergent specifically created for vinyl home siding to assist get rid of dirt and mold. Apply it with your pressure washing machine or a pump sprayer, permitting it to sit for about 10 mins.
